Level 2 electricians play a pivotal role in connecting individual structures to the wider electrical facilities, a responsibility that is often underappreciated. In regions such as New South Wales, Victoria, and Queensland, this classification signifies a high level of proficiency that exceeds basic electricians, who concentrate on internal wiring, Level 2 electricians possess the authority to deal with the external service upkeep however also the rapidly developing field of renewable energy options.
The primary duty of a Level 2 electrician focuses on the service mains, which are the cable televisions that bring electrical energy from the street to the accessory point on your residential or commercial property, whether above or below ground. This involves jobs like establishing, fixing, and taking care of these crucial components. Picture a brand-new building and construction task: a Level 2 electrician has to connect the property to the power network before any internal electrical wiring can be triggered. This can include responsibilities such as updating service lines to support higher power needs, installing brand-new metering gadgets, or moving existing electrical structures. Their task often involves dealing with power poles, underground pits, and high-voltage parts, making it naturally more intricate and dangerous compared to general electrical jobs.
Among the most common reasons to engage a Level 2 electrician is for a service upgrade. As homes accumulate more power-hungry devices, from a/c to electric lorry chargers, the existing electrical service might end up being inadequate. A Level 2 electrician will examine the present capability, determine the brand-new load requirements, and after that install thicker cables and a bigger main switchboard to securely deal with the increased demand. This not just avoids power outages and circuit overloads but also ensures the long-term safety and efficiency of the electrical system.
In addition, recognizing and repairing concerns with the electrical service line is a job that needs the knowledge of a Level 2 electrician. When a power blackout takes place and it's not caused by a problem with the internal electrical system, the concern is likely with the main electrical supply. This could be due to damaged circuitry caused by weather condition, animal damage, or outdated facilities. A Level 2 electrician has the essential tools and understanding to securely find and fix these external issues, frequently operating in challenging conditions and following stringent security guidelines set by the regional power business. By isolating and fixing these vital connections, they can rapidly restore power and decrease the effect on households and businesses.
Beyond regular installations and repairs, Level 2 electricians play a considerable function in emergency situations. Storms, lorry mishaps, or even unanticipated equipment failures can result in downed power lines or harmed metering equipment. In such circumstances, a Level 2 electrician is often the first responder, operating in combination with or individually for the regional network service provider to make the location safe, isolate broken sections, and start repairs. Their fast action and technical efficiency are crucial in mitigating threats and restoring power to affected locations.
The increasing use of renewable energy, specifically rooftop planetary systems, has highlighted the important function of Level 2 electricians. While regular electricians set up the solar panels and inverters, Level 2 electricians are frequently required to connect these systems to the grid. Their duties consist of upgrading the main switchboard to support solar power export, installing new bi-directional meters, and ensuring the smooth and safe integration of renewable energy into the current electrical setup. This necessary link allows surplus solar power to be dispersed back to the grid, bringing benefits to both homeowners and the more comprehensive community.
Getting a Level 2 accreditation is a rigorous process, requiring extensive experience, specialised training, and a deep understanding of network security regulations. Unlike a basic electrician who primarily handles low-voltage electrical wiring within a home, Level 2 electricians are authorised to deal with and near live service device, consisting of the connections to the network poles. This needs a detailed knowledge of the various service classifications, such as overhead and underground services, and the get more info particular treatments for dealing with live or de-energised high-voltage infrastructure. The continuous training and recertification requirements make sure that Level 2 electricians stay current with developing technologies and safety requirements.
